This week’s guest is Gina Bianchini, CEO of Mighty Networks, the cultural software platform for creators, entrepreneurs, and brands to build communities.Gina is an incredible entrepreneur, category designer and leader who recently wrote her first book, the Wall Street Journal bestseller Purpose: Design a Community & Change Your Life.Gina and Ollie discuss:Why leaders thrive when asking generative, future-oriented questions.How establishing a clear purpose helps you attract similarly-minded people.How powerful questions lead to transformative change (and how to ask them).Why, whether in a community or organisation, engagement is fuelled by a shared mission.How to turn your interest – however niche – into a community that you can monetise.LINKS:Mighty NetworksPurpose: Design a Community & Change Your Life.Gina’s LinkedInYou can get in touch or find out more about me using one of the links below:Book me to speak with your team.Ollie's LinkedInFuture Work/Life NewsletterMy bestselling book, Work/Life Flywheel: Harness the work revolution and reimagine your career without fear, is out now.
